The Scinfaxi

For thousands of years the Scinfaxi had spread across the Orion Arm. A parasitoid alien consciousness, the Scinfaxi mind was driven by the simple need to expand, to spread the virus that sustained them. Unable to even conceptualize failure, they swept across the galaxy. On planets that harbored life The Virus absorbed all it touched, transforming once fertile worlds into barren husks of Scinfaxi growth.

Sentient life, while rare had been encountered by the Scinfaxi periodically over the course of their expansion. While the spread of The Virus had been slowed considerably by resistance, over time such resistance withered and the nature of the conquered races was absorbed into the Scinfaxi mind. In several cases the process of absorption was left incomplete as elements of the opposing races escaped from the grasp of the Scinfaxi into space. While unfortunate, the Scinfaxi were content with the knowledge that sooner or later the advance of the Virus would catch up with those remnants.

In the 12th century the elder pioneers of the Scinfaxi race encountered Earth. To their collective mind the human race was an enigma. The thought processes of humanity were odd and crippled to them, devoid of telepathy and trapped in a cauldron of emotion. Nevertheless the world was in the path of the Scinfaxi advance and despite the peculiarities of the inhabitants a conversion ship was sent.

The Invasion

With the arrival of the conversion ship in 1943, the Scinfaxi mind was as close to astonished as their race could perceive. Unlike the other species they had encountered, humanity had advanced technologically far faster than they would have believed possible. In the end however it changed nothing, Scinfaxi ships landed across the planet spreading The Virus across the atmosphere.

Already embroiled in the Second World War an unprepared for such an event of this magnitude, humanity was at first incapable of withstanding the onslaught. But even as cities burned and one green pastures were replaced by fields of red Scinfaxi growth, the leaders of the greatest nations on Earth forged an alliance of desperation.

The United States, British Empire, Greater German Reich, Soviet Union, and the Empire of Japan agreed to an immediate armistice and for the first time in history all the peoples of Earth were united in a common purpose, against a common foe.

Even unified however, resistance to the Scinfaxi seemed hopeless. Asia was transformed into a monstrous killing field as untold millions were swept up in the Scinfaxi advance, with millions more now refugees seeking a safe haven from the destruction.

In Europe and Africa the situation was the same, as civilization broke down across the continent, the masses of humanity sought any refuge they could find. In desperation the British Empire and Third Reich turned to chemical weapons, as their armies turned from a strategy of static defense to coordinated withdrawals meant to buy time for civilian evacuees. The British Isles in particular were nearly emptied of civilians as the United Kingdom was drastically reorganized to provide the means of a continuance of government.

Across the Atlantic, the Americas were split in two as Scinfaxi occupied territories stretched from Argentina to Illinois. Compounded with an immense refugee crisis, US control of the westernmost states collapsed, forcing a separate emergency government into existence.

In the Soviet Union resistance to the invaders was aided by the vast distances of the nation. And while the great cities of Russia were spared, the fertile fields of the Ukraine were ravaged by the Virus and the Soviets now faced an immense food shortage. Combined with the influx of millions upon millions of Asian refugees, the Soviet government seemed to be on the verge of collapse.

However in 1944 the first glimmer of hope appeared. In the ruins of Zyhtomyr the Soviet Union and Nazi Germany were able to obtain quantities of an immensely reactive material out of the ruins of a Scinfaxi starship. With this newfound material, the Soviet Union detonated humanities first atomic bomb a year later, sacrificing an entire city to blunt the Scinfaxi advance.

As startling as these developments were to the Scinfaxi, another element was even more devasting. The Virus which had successfully spread across hundreds if not thousands of worlds had begun to wither. While it was still present in abundance within the world’s southern hemisphere, as winter set across the north, the Scinfaxi advance stalled.

Faced with atomic detonations across their areas of advance, and the death of the Virus, the Scinfaxi were forced to consolidate their gains and enact new methods of conversion. Against all odds, the human race had been spared.

The Aftermath

While the direct threat of the Scinfaxi had been overcome the remaining nations of Earth still faced a monumental challenge. The massive destruction suffered in the war and the resulting refugee crisis transformed human geography overnight.

The Greater German Reich was forced to withdraw from many of its conquests made during the Second World War and consolidate its manpower intro restoring Central and Western Europe. The destruction of nearly the entirety of the German Leadership forced the Reich to dramatically change its structure and policies. While it retained the iconography and image of the Nazi Party, it was no longer the same nation.
The removal of German troops from Eastern Europe granted the Soviet Union an opportunity to reclaim lost territories which it quickly seized upon. Flooded with refugees from Asia, the Soviet Union was in dire need of arable land to feed its massive population. Red Army troops advanced as far as Sofia, eager to claim as much territory as could be had.

In Siberia the arrival of so many evacuees, primarily Chinese created a new cultural identity in the Soviet Union. Maoist theories and doctrines soon held equal weight in the Kremlin to Marxist-Leninist schools of thought. While racial unrest and threats of insurgencies were common, the Soviet Union was able to remain intact.

Anxious to avoid the fate which had befallen Eastern Europe the nations of Scandinavia, now free from German occupation formed a collective pact of military and economic assistance. The Federal Nordic Cooperative, while fragile, would create a new independent nation, the last bulwark of democracy in mainland Europe.

Japan, spared the invasion of its homeland that had befallen the other nations, retreated into a period of isolation. While its civilian population had been sparred, its military assets had been shattered. While it retained control of much of its colonial possessions, it would spend the next two decades ensuring it could maintain them.

North America was perhaps most transformed by the conflict. As the haven for millions upon millions of refugees from all across the word, the United States and Canada were forever transformed. Canada became the new center of the remaining British Empire, its vast territories providing for all the British Commonwealth refugees who no longer had nations to return to. The arrival of a great French population who had taken advantage of German disorder successfully succeeded Quebec, creating a new French government a state of semi-exile. Hundreds of thousands more escaped into North America from nations that no longer existed with nowhere else to go they were allowed to settle in specific areas and denied freedom of movement. Branded the "Nations Within Nations" program, it effectively created a population of second class citizens.

America, which had been split into two nations during the war, was faced with the task of reunification. Yet so great was the devastation that no agreement could be made on a united reconstruction effort. While committed to an economic union, the Andrean Republic and United States of America would be left to rebuild as separate nations.

The greatest change however was the new border that extended from California to the Mediterranean to Mongolia to New Guinea. All the nations of Earth now faced a new and terrible threat that threatened to resurface at any moment.

The Space Race

The activities of the Scinfaxi within the Quarantine Zone were totally unknown to humanity, nearly permanently concealed beneath great black clouds; thousands of black towers appeared, directing massive amounts of an unknown energy into the atmosphere. While the specific nature of these machines could only be guessed at, reconnaissance was attempted at every opportunity.

In the late 1950s a hypothesis developed, one that was not shared with the general public. It was theorized the towers were somehow altering the planets environment, adapting it to better suit the Scinfaxi and their Virus. If continued unabated, it was estimated the planet would no longer be suitable for human life within 300 years.

The great powers realized this independently and met in secret to discuss the future of the human race. While nuclear weaponry had proven effective during the war, the number of bombs required to eliminate the Scinfaxi would surely destroy mankind as well. The options seemed limited to a Scinfaxi holocaust or an atomic one.

After weeks of debate the German representatives announced a third alternative. Experimenting with the Scinfaxi fuel source, and using it as a basis for terrestrial alternatives they had already made significant advances in rocketry and heat shielding. With further development, and international cooperation, colonizing extrasolar planets might be possible.

That international cooperation never became a reality, the nations of Earth having reverted to a pre-invasion mindset in regards to their human neighbors. The advance into space however became the focal point of each nation, and after numerous rocket and satellite launches, the Greater German Reich became the first nation to land a man on the moon in 1967.

After that, the space race intensified, the newly formed Allied Federation and the Soviet Union achieved their own moon landings in the following years and decades, and by the year 2000 13 different manned stations were in orbit of the Earth.

Spreading across the Solar System gave mankind access to new resources and new opportunities but the threat of a resurgent Scinfaxi was never far from the minds of human leaders. The Solar System was viewed not as the final frontier of human exploration, but rather as a mere stepping stone to the thousands of stars that lay beyond.

The Colonization Programs

When the slow transformation of Earth by the Scinfaxi towers became public knowledge in 2034, public support for space exploration exploded. The Soviet Union, German Reich, and Imperial Japan were able to leverage this support into a “total war” mindset. Each nation became utterly devoted to the goal of escaping the Solar System, building infrastructure and conducting research at an increasingly rapid rate.

It was the United States however that made the greatest breakthrough. It’s immense private industry and academic freedom was perfectly suited to the great task facing humanity. In 2085 an unmanned spacecraft made the first faster than light jump, jumping from Mars to Pluto in roughly 4 minutes. Manned spacecraft soon followed suite and the construction of the first interstellar fleet begun.

Hundreds of systems had been cataloged for possible expansion in the preceding decades and now both automated and manned probes undertook survey missions to find the best locations for the first human colonies. Alpha Centauri, home to a planet that could be terraformed in a matter of months and rich with vast amounts of resources became the site for mankind’s first extrasolar colony.

The expense of establishing such a colony was too great for any one nation however, and the Allied Federation proposed a joint effort with the other major powers. Eager to gain experience in extrasolar settlement and interstellar logistics, the Soviet Union and Greater German Reich accepted. Only Imperial Japan was not involved, preferring to remain in relative isolation.

The terraforming of Alpha Centauri and the establishment of the first colonies achieved a success well in excess of even the most optimistic predictions. The plants and simple animals and insects that survived the terraforming process were discovered to be quite primitive when compared to life on Earth; Terran crops swept aside all native life enabling self-sufficiency on the colony in under a year.

What could have been the first example of rewarding cooperation between the nations involved however soon became strangled in politics and began to decay. What began as a symbol of hope and peace, the Alpha Centauri colony was reduced to a bargaining chip, as each nation leveraged their support for the colony to affect politics on Earth.

The colony descended into riots as its populace fell into nationalist or secessionist movements, basic services fell apart and for a period of nearly three weeks the colony was without any recognized government. Combined with the drastically falling cost of manufacturing faster than light vessels and supporting off- world colonies Alpha Centauri was granted independence, the minority of colonists still loyal to their respective superpower were shipped to the newly forming Soviet, German, and Allied colonies across the Orion Arm.

The Sol Treaties

By the start of the 22nd century the environment of Earth had begun to deteriorate, the effects of the Scinfaxi devices in the Southern Hemisphere were now being felt across the globe as the atmosphere itself grew deadly.

The race off-world intensified and the role of private corporations greatly increased, soon colonization charters were granted to private citizens free to establish colonies outside the rule of any major government. Dozens and then hundreds of privately funded colonies were established, and while the majority eventually became state funded and merged into the territories of one of the superpowers, a small remained seperate and grew into independent nations, mirroring the development of Alpha Centauri.

These neutral colonies became of great importance to the Allied Federation as it struggled to transport those part of the "Nations Within Nations" program off world. In an effort to provide a new home for people they could not hope to accommodate on their colonies, the "Sanctuary Worlds" program was created. In return for accepting refugees from Earth, neutral colonies would receive economic incentives and aid in the future.

The arrival of hundreds of thousands of people across a few dozen worlds created a demographic crisis across the Solar Sector. Colonies that once thought as themselves as German or English now identified as Cetians, Gallerians or Tanarsians.

Wary over the potential for future conflicts and heavily invested in the unfettered development of their own colonies, the nations of Earth and the newly formed independent colonies signed a series of treaties that would later become known as the Sol Doctrine. The Soviet Union, Greater German Reich, Empire of Japan and the member states of the Allied Federation would settle no worlds in any system already claimed by one another power and the sovereignty of the neutral colonies would be respected. Any colonies in violation of these terms prior to the signing of these treaties would be relocated or offered independence. The Sol Doctrine would become one of the guiding tenants of human exploration, creating tangible power blocs for each power and giving rise to modern interstellar politics.

The Second Scinfaxi War

On Earth the last remnants of humanity were steadily transported to the colonies. The Scinfaxi Virus, so successfully contained in the southern hemisphere now began to spread north, outbreaks occurred in every region and the effects of winter no longer hindered its spread. The Scinfaxi were finally ready to resume their conquest.

All across the quarantine zone alien tripods advanced into human territories in such ferocity not seen since their initial landings. Modern human weaponry, infinitely more advanced than their predecessors in World War 2 proved no more capable against Scinfaxi weaponry and produced only the slightest resistance.

It was moment humanity had prepared for and transports departing for the colonies left every hour of every day. Transports in service all across the human colonies were repurposed and sent back to Earth to assist in the evacuation.
The Second Scinfaxi War preceded much like the first, delaying actions were fought on the outskirts of every remaining city, buying precious hours for those on the transports. The war grew in scale as Scinfaxi aircraft no longer restricted to targets simply on the surface of Earth attacked ships across the system. Unprepared for space warfare hundreds of human starships were lost.

Three years after their advance resumed the Scinfaxi claimed the last pockets of human territory on Earth. In a last act of defiance, thousands of nuclear weapons were launched at the surface of the planet, and the entire system was placed in quarantine. No human would ever set foot on the surface of the Earth again.

The Golden Age of Exploration

The next century saw humanity re-establish its civilization as an interstellar one. Colonies grew, prospered, and soon rivaled Earth at its height in both population and industrial development. While the vast majority of these worlds were under the control of the superpowers, many remained independent, some recognizable as predecessors of smaller Earth nations while others totally unique with no cultural identity dating past the evacuation. While none of these nations could never hope to match the superpowers in any capacity, regional and middle powers emerged, seeking their own spheres of influence and at times challenging one another for control.

The great task of reconstruction over, old rivalries began to take hold and the great nations began to redevelop their militaries, reading themselves for the next major war, whether it be against the Scinfaxi or a human neighbor. On many worlds, particularly those with more than one independent nation state, conflicts broke out, often thinly veiled proxy wars between larger, more powerful nations. On Juno, Sirus, Joseph, Heinlein, Silverhold, Welles, the list goes on, wars were fought between those of different religion, ideology or benefactor.

With the cost of interstellar travel now reduced to within the means of the average citizen, a large piracy element was born, eager to prey on shipping often dozens of light years from the nearest protected system. Even the poorest of nations could operate a fleet of spacecraft, and havens for those operating outside the law appeared across the Orion Arm.

God1g.jpg

Dawn of Victory

Nowhere in the Orion Arm was the situation more perilous then on the border worlds between the Soviet Union and the Greater German Reich. Their mutual hatred undeterred throughout the centuries each began plans to move against the other.
The star systems of Tanarus, Galleria, and Orson became the setting for the next great game between the powers. Both sought influence there with the local independent nations, providing military aid, economic assistance and even deploying observers. Rivalry between the two powers intensified and it became only a matter of time before open conflict between the two superpowers would ignite.

When war broke out between two alliances on Tanarsus the seeds of a greater future conflict began to grow. The Greater German Reich and Soviet Union both gave nearly unlimited assistance to their respective alliances on the planet investing everything to win influence over a vital strategic system. When the war ended with the victory of communist-aligned nations, the Soviet Union finally had a vital system from which to launch an invasion of the Reich.

It was the Greater German Reich that struck first however, under the pretence of preventing further Soviet aid to the nations of Tanarsus it moved to occupy the system starting a chain of events that would start the Soviet-German war.

Tanarsus, Galleria, and Orson became battlegrounds for a conflict never before seen in human history. Thousands of starships, millions of troops were deployed to a front extending across a dozen worlds. Since then the conflict has only escalated, seeking to open a new front and break the stalemate, the Greater German Reich has broken the Sol Doctrine and invaded the German breakaway colony of Vega, a system at the heart of interstellar trade.

No better is the situation between the Empire of Japan and the Democratic Federation, as in moves paralleling those on the Tanarsus, have backed nations in proxy wars across the Orion Arm.

Worse still is the fact that the Scinfaxi are not blind to the rise and expansion of humanity. As the old alliances of mankind fall apart they begin their plans to complete what they had started nearly three centuries before.
